Optimal Storage and HandlingPhenyl Thiochloroformate should be kept in a cool, dry, and well-ventilated area with the container tightly sealed to maintain stability and extend shelf life. Due to its moisture sensitivity and pungent smell, avoid humidity and exposure to water, which causes decomposition. HDPE drums and glass bottles are recommended for safe storage and transport, ensuring reliable containment and protection during handling.

Safety and Transport GuidanceTransport Phenyl Thiochloroformate in accordance with UN 2927 regulations, citing its classification as a toxic, corrosive organic liquid. Always wear appropriate protective equipment during handling to avoid inhalation or skin contact. Proper transport containment minimizes risk and ensures compliance with international standards, safeguarding personnel and the environment during movement and storage.

Q: How should Phenyl Thiochloroformate be stored to maintain its shelf life and quality?
A: Phenyl Thiochloroformate needs storage in a cool, dry, and well-ventilated area, inside tightly sealed HDPE drums or glass bottles. Avoid exposure to moisture, as the compound is sensitive and decomposes in water. Proper storage extends its shelf life to 12 months and maintains its purity (assay over 98%).

Q: Where is Phenyl Thiochloroformate manufactured and supplied from?
A: This chemical is typically manufactured, exported, and supplied from India. The use of industrial grade raw materials, such as benzene thiol and phosgene, contributes to its consistent high purity and quality.
Q: What is the process for transporting Phenyl Thiochloroformate safely?
A: Phenyl Thiochloroformate should be transported according to UN 2927 guidelinesclassified as a toxic, corrosive organic liquidusing HDPE drums or glass bottles suitable for international shipping standards to ensure safety and compliance.
